The Best Colour Correctors for Dark Circles & Pigmentation

When it comes to achieving that airbrushed complexion, there’s one tool in your kit that you’re probably missing: a colour corrector.
These pretty pastel hues are your fast-track pass to a totally even visage, helping to fix even the most stubborn of skin woes. The best way to cheat a fully rested visage is to invest in a decent colour correcting palette, and luckily for you, we have a fair few recommendations.
Not sure where to begin? Let’s start by running through what each shade does for you and your complexion (hint: sleepy gals will definitely want to purchase the orange hue).
Green colour corrector:
Don’t worry, applying a green hue to your face is not as daunting as it sounds! Red and blemish-prone skin types will benefit most from this colour corrector. The green hues balance out unwanted redness, making it the ideal tool to minimise the severity of acne scars and newly formed spots.
Orange colour corrector:
Ideal for dark circles and blue undereye bags, the orange colour corrector banishes any signs of tiredness and fatigue. We love this shade for brightening up dull spots and the tell-tale signs of booze-fuelled nights.
Yellow colour corrector:
This tone is used on warmer and olive skin tones, highlighting key areas whilst also concealing any grey areas. It can also be used on blue/brown under eye bags.
Purple colour corrector:
We recommend using the purple colour corrector on washed-out skin tones. This vibrant colour may seem a little intimidating at first but once blended in helps to fight off the appearance of sallow skin.
Peach colour corrector:
Used on darker tones, the peach shade is used as a base for under eyes and works particularly well with concealer. It’s important to not use too much of this shade though!
